How do I maintain and install a ceiling metal fan cover safely?
p To install and care for a ceiling metal fan cover, start by turning off power and removing any old cover. Secure the new cover using the correct canopy adapter and mounting screws. Clean regularly with a soft cloth and mild detergent; avoid harsh chemicals that can corrode metal. Check that the cover does not touch moving blades and that there is proper clearance.
